Public disrupt the plying of five buses that arrive late everyday

Coimbatore, Dec. 23

Five government buses were prevented from plying by the public alleging that they arrive late everyday causing inconvenience to the public. Six buses of the Bus Route No. 74 ply between Vellalore and Gandhipuram. Since these buses do not arrive at Vellalore on time in the morning, school and college students are invariably delayed in reaching their institutions.



Consequently, the public stopped five of the buses from plying. The protest was called off when the transport officials and the police pacified them. As a result of the protest, the traffic near Vellalore was held up for an hour.
